This article analyzes the composition of export agency fees, covering the mainstream billing models in 2025, the identification of common additional fees, and cost optimization techniques, helping foreign trade enterprises establish a scientific service fee evaluation system.

What are the main charging models adopted?
In 2025,the mainstream billing models will present three main types:
- All-inclusivepricing:Chargedat0.8%-2%ofthecargovalue,includingbasiccustomsdeclaration,documentpreparation,andbasiclogisticscoordination.
- Sectionalcharging:
- Basichandlingfee:2000-5000yuan/ticket
- Customsdeclarationsurcharge:Anadditionalchargeof300-800yuanisappliedforspecialsupervisionmodes.
- CertificateProcessingFee:Itemizedbycertificatetype
- Performance-based fee: Basic service fee + tax rebate sharing (commonly seen in bulk trade,with a tax rebate differential sharing ratio ranging from 3:7 to 5:5)
How to Identify Hidden Additional Fees?
It is recommended to focus on the following three types of potential costs:
- Emergencyhandlingfee:Customsinspectionemergencychannelfee(singleuse:800-2000RMB)
- SpecialDocumentHandlingFee:Including:
- Non-standarddocumenttranslationfee(80-150RMB/page)
- Expeditedfeeforconsularauthentication(2-3timestheembassy/consulatefee)
- Exchange Rate Fluctuation Compensation Fund: Some agency contracts include a 0.3%-0.5% exchange rate fluctuation risk reserve.
How should the total cost be calculated?
Scientific computing should encompass three dimensions:
- ExplicitCosts:Theagencyservicefee+officialfees(suchasthelatestfeesin2025)Productswitha9%raterequirecalculationofthetaxrefunddifference)
- TimeCost:Thecapitaloccupationcostcausedbythedifferenceinaveragecustomsclearancetime(adelayof1day≈0.03%ofthecargovalue).
- Riskcost:Includingcompliancerisks(suchasthecaseofacompanybeingorderedtopaybacktaxesduetoaclassificationerrorin2024)andtheprobabilityofbreachofcontractcompensation.
What new cost optimization directions will there be in 2025?
It is recommended to focus on the opportunities brought by the following three new policies:
- RCEPcumulativerules:Eligiblegoodscanapplyfora7-15%tariffreduction.
- Intelligentcustomsdeclarationsystem:TheAPIserviceintegratedwiththeCustomsSingleWindowcanreducedocumentprocessingcostsby30%.
- GreenChannelEnterprise:TheinspectionrateforAEO-certifiedenterprisesisreducedto0.8%(comparedto3.2%forordinaryenterprises).
How to avoid billing traps?
It is recommended to implement three preventive measures:
- ContractTermsReview:Payspecialattentiontothe"catch-allclause"regarding"otherpotentialfees."
- FeeComparisonTable:Requestforthe2025editionofthe"InternationalTradeServiceFeeReferencePriceList"forcomparison.
- Installmentpaymentmechanism:Itisrecommendedtomakephasedpaymentsaccordingtooperationalmilestones(30%uponbooking,50%uponcompletionofcustomsclearance).
What cost indicators should be considered when selecting an agent?
Key evaluation focuses on three core metrics:
- Unitvalueservicecost:Totalcost/Exportvalue(Excellentagentscontrolitwithin0.6%-1.2%)
- Abnormaleventhandlingcost:Includingcustomsauditresponsecosts(normalagencyfeesareincludedintheservicecharge)
- Capitalturnoverefficiency:Theaveragecyclefrombookingtotaxrefund(high-qualityagentscanbe5-7workingdaysfasterthantheindustryaverage)
